Hard Skills
IntermediateLeather Pliability ManagementThe ability to apply heat, steam, or oils to adjust the stiffness of glove leather for optimal shaping.
IntermediatePrecision Pocket ShapingUtilizing specialized mallets and shaping blocks to form the glove pocket and fingers to specific dimensions and depths.
AdvancedPosition-Specific CustomizationKnowledge of the unique functional requirements for different baseball positions to tailor the glove shape accordingly.
BasicQuality Control InspectionThe process of identifying structural flaws, stitching issues, or leather irregularities during and after the shaping process.
BasicIndustrial Tool MaintenanceCleaning and maintaining shaping tools such as industrial steamers, mallets, and shaping forms to ensure longevity and safety.
